Both have $$( -COCH_3)$$ group, but haloform is formed in (a) only. Explain.

Solution

Due to steric hindrance of two $$(-CH_3)$$ groups in the ortho position with respect to $$(-COCH_3)$$ in (b), $$CHCl_3$$ is not formed in reaction (b).
